Exclusive-OR With Accumulator
TMS320C1x and TMS320C2x devices: Exclusive-OR
the contents of the addressed data-memory location
with 16 LSBs of the accumulator. The MSBs are not af-
fected.
TMS320C2xx and TMS320C5x devices: Exclusive-
OR the contents of the addressed data-memory loca-
tion or a 16-bit immediate value with the accumulator.
If a shift is specified, left shift the value before perform-
ing the exclusive-OR operation. Low-order bits below
and high-order bits above the shifted value are treated
as 0s.

Exclusive-OR of ACCB With Accumulator
Exclusive-OR the contents of the accumulator with the
contents of the ACCB. The results are placed in the ac-
cumulator.

Exclusive-OR Immediate With Accumulator With
Shift
Exclusive-OR a 16-bit immediate value with the accu-
mulator. If a shift is specified, left shift the value before
peforming the exclusive-OR operation. Low-order bits
below and high-order bits above the shifted value are
treated as 0s.

Exclusive-OR of Long Immediate or DBMR
With Addressed Data-Memory Value
If a long immediate value is specified, exclusive OR it
with the addressed data-memory value; otherwise, ex-
clusive OR the DBMR with the addressed data-
memory value. Write the result back to the data-
memory location. The accumulator is not affected.

Zero Low Accumulator and Load High
Accumulator
Clear the 16 LSBs of the accumulator to 0 and load the
contents of the addressed data-memory location into
the 16 MSBs of the accumulator.
